    Ultium Footswitch SmartLead User Manual 5 General Warnings and Cautions 5.1 Risks and Benefits There is no identified risk of physical harm or injury with use of the Footswitch SmartLead. The benefit provided by use of the device is the provision of objective measures to assess the severity of pathological human movement conditions and gauge any subsequent improvement offered by therapy, training, prosthetic alterations or ergonomic design changes.

    Ultium Footswitch SmartLead User Manual 8 Pre-Use Check 8.1 Normal Appearance of Signals The sensor’s STATUS LED provides a means of communicating its operational state. In the idle state, the STATUS LED will flash blue at a low, once per second rate. When the sensor is actively measuring a signal, the STATUS LED will flash recognizably faster (green).

  • Page 22 Ultium Footswitch SmartLead User Manual 9.2.2 Foot Insole The Foot Insole is convenient to use because it does not require individual sensors to be attached to the foot. The Insole fits inside the shoe which makes it the easiest and fastest method to measure foot pressure.

    Ultium Footswitch SmartLead User Manual 16.2 Appendix B – Insole measurements The insoles are worn in the subject's shoes or taped to the bottom of bare feet. The foot insole has 4 zones – toe, metatarsal 1, metatarsal 5, heel. The heel section is separated from the fore foot section so that one pair of insoles can accommodate a range of shoe sizes.
